Alexandria Real Estate Equities, Inc. (NYSE:ARE), an S&P 500® company, is an urban office REIT uniquely focused on world-class collaborative life science and technology campuses in AAA innovation cluster locations. Founded in 1994, Alexandria pioneered this niche and has since established a significant market presence in key locations, including Greater Boston, San Francisco, New York City, San Diego, Seattle, Maryland, and Research Triangle Park. Alexandria is known for its high-quality and diverse tenant base. Alexandria has a longstanding and proven track record of developing Class A properties clustered in urban life science and technology campuses that provide its innovative tenants with highly dynamic and collaborative environments that enhance their ability to successfully recruit and retain world-class talent and inspire productivity, efficiency, creativity, and success. We are seeking a Property Management Coordinator in our Maryland office. The incumbent will be a highly skilled individual, who will be providing general office support to the Asset Services team, administering and coordinating any tenant and amenity related matters, and participating in all areas of portfolio management.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

Administration

  • Provide assistance with the host of amenities including but not limited to: restaurants, fitness centers, conferencing spaces, event spaces, organic gardens, memberships, etc.
  • Initiate tenant notification letters and e-mails as needed.
  • Assist Asset Services Team with special projects.
  • Assist in planning all tenant events, parties, gifts.
  • Assist in annual budget preparation.
  • Track tenant receivables.
  • Maintain budget tracking spreadsheet.
  • Assist in all aspects of property maintenance.
  • Redirect and prioritize work requests including entering tenant work orders in the Angus work order system. Responsible for the Angus close out of both tenant requests and PM work orders.
  • Follows up with tenants to ensure satisfaction with tenant work requests.
  • Participate in site operating meetings.
  • Responsible for drafting and sending distribution email blasts to tenants.
  • Responsible for distributing and maintaining the tenant welcome package for the site.

Contract Administration

  • Participate in bid process when searching for new vendors.
  • Prepare all service contracts.
  • Track contracts with pending signatures.
  • Maintain spreadsheets to track all current contracts in region.
  • Maintain current and complete certificate of insurance for all tenants and all vendors.
  • Review all limits, coverage types, expirations and additional insured for compliance.

Accounts Payable

  • Type, file and maintain purchase orders and invoice files.
  • Match packing slips and purchase orders to invoices, code and obtain Manager’s approval.
  • Research invoices in Nexus when necessary.
  • Audit open purchase orders on a monthly basis.
  • Prepare utility cost/consumption reports when necessary. Manage utility accounts in Measurbl.

Qualifications and Experience: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Business, Accounting, or Finance preferred.
  • 1 - 3 years of experience in property management, real estate, event management and/or hospitality field preferred.
  • Strong accounting background and familiarity with lease provisions and lease administration a plus.
  • Proficient in MS Office (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ook) a must.
  • Experience in Angus and JDE a plus.
  • Adobe InDesign experience, a plus.
  • Client service oriented attitude a must.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
  • Willingness to work as part of a team and support the team.
  • Desire to pursue career in commercial real estate industry a plus.
